Latest Patents
Yoles' latest patents focus on the use of copolymer 1 and related peptides and polypeptides in conjunction with activated T cells for neuroprotective therapy. These methods aim to promote nerve regeneration and prevent neuronal degeneration within both the central and peripheral nervous systems. In one embodiment, activated T cells that recognize an antigen of copolymer 1 or its related peptides are administered to enhance nerve regeneration. In another embodiment, copolymer 1 or its related peptides are directly administered to achieve similar therapeutic effects. The versatility of these treatments allows for the administration of activated T cells alone or in combination with copolymer 1 or its related peptides.
